JavaScript is not enabled.
Too much food - Review by menuism m | Venus Bar & Restaurant

Venus Bar & Restaurant

Claim

Too much food 2/21/2011

goose1234 Provided by Partner
It's a rinky dinky place but look out , the food is great, it's all about spanish food here, so get ready for the ride of your life, all kinds of s... more
Summer SALE!!!:
15% OFF all yearly plans
Use year15 at checkout. Expires 1/1/2021